Output 85ba388cafadf834c22c26f30cdc2fcaff9c7e93d7c33fd4ddba6e36738340e5:131

value
643420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45e7edcc6d3015d6d924a4b5ec09e3b33f27a6b4 OP_EQUAL
address
384ePUwdPrpSB9Z5D5LNrTmZvUcC7rH2Pd
transaction
85ba388cafadf834c22c26f30cdc2fcaff9c7e93d7c33fd4ddba6e36738340e5
spent
true